OK interesting.. I got a board here for recap 1D.4

tested with TF1230 and got a guru.

as newer A1200 and ReAmiga 1200 have NO components put obn E125R, E125C, E123R, E123C I removed all those and then it worked fine..

checking where they end up. they go to NOTHING! they are basically (very) small antennas and nothing else. so commodore was right in their technotyes: those should be removed. not just the caps but the resistors aswell

Ok so I solved my `Not Booting on 3.1 rom`

I tried all the suggestions as mentioned here by Chucky and still no joy but was getting a purple screen, and all the info on the interwebs points it to a ROM fault , but mine are orignal 3.1 so I thought must be good, anyways cut a long story short I tried an old pair of EPROM 3.1 roms and I got a partial boot ! hmmm but tried everything and stil no full booting but progress

So in the end I flashed the excellent USB Rom Emulators by CMORELY on here with 3.1 rom images and bingo ! worked out of the Trap !

So all I can say regarding this problem is perhaps our 30 year 3.1 roms are slowly dying , so please someone else try another set of 3.1 roms or burn a set to see if you get the same result
